imageA while back I would have advocated a standard site layout: header, footer and content in between with a sidebar on the left or the right. But things have changed, people use phones and tablets to browse the Internet and they scroll rather than click. So I had a bit of a rethink and came up with a theme that was built for touch screens but works equally well on a desktop. It still has a header and footer but there in no sidebar and the homepage is a long scrolling page of content. There will be those who complain about the lack of a sidebar but my answer to them is: change the way you do things. Don’t sit in front of a massive screen and build a site that suits you, pick up your phone and build a site that works for someone browsing on the train or in the pub.

My solution is a one page scrolling theme.
